Ingredients
Scale
Here’s what you’ll need to whip up these delicious burgers:
- 1 pound ground beef (preferably 80/20 for juiciness)
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/2 teaspoon onion powder
- 4 burger buns
- 4 slices of cheddar cheese
- 1 tablespoon butter
- 1/2 cup whiskey
- 1/4 cup beef broth
- 1/4 cup heavy cream
- 1 tablespoon brown sugar
- 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
- 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
- Salt and pepper to taste
If you’re out of ground beef, feel free to substitute with ground turkey or chicken. For the whiskey, choose one that you enjoy sipping, as its flavor will shine through in the sauce. And if you’re looking to make things a bit healthier, you can swap out the heavy cream for a lighter option.
Instructions
Now, let’s get cooking! Here’s how you make these delightful burgers:
- In a large bowl, combine the ground beef, salt, pepper, garlic powder, and onion powder. Mix gently with your hands until well combined, being careful not to overwork the meat.
- Divide the mixture into four equal portions and shape each into a patty.
- Heat a skillet over medium-high heat and add the patties. Cook for about 4-5 minutes on each side, or until they reach your desired level of doneness.
- While the burgers are cooking, melt the butter in a separate saucepan over medium heat.
- Add the whiskey to the saucepan and let it simmer for about 2 minutes to cook off the alcohol.
- Stir in the beef broth, heavy cream, brown sugar, Worcestershire sauce, and Dijon mustard. Let the sauce simmer until it thickens slightly, about 5 minutes.
- Once the burgers are cooked, top each with a slice of cheddar cheese and cover the skillet with a lid for a minute to melt the cheese.
- Toast the burger buns lightly if desired.
- Assemble the burgers by placing each patty on a bun, then drizzling with the whiskey sauce. Top with the other half of the bun.
